It’s Pumpkin Spice season which is showcased in this pattern paper from the Rustic Harvest pack. Add a Hello There sentiment from the Nature’s Prints stamp set to a Jar punch for a focal point. The Brushed Brass Butterflies add a touch of whimsy.

The Painted Texture 3D Embossing Folder adds background interest. The Evening Evergreen Windowpane Check Ribbon completes the design.
